Abstract

The open a kind of iron filings of the present invention are from arranging device, including housing and scraper component, the end face of described housing is smooth flat, the side of described housing is semi arch shiny surface, described side is provided with and the described scraper component of described side Intermittent Contact away from the side of described housing, the magnet assemblies that can move it is provided with along described shell inner surface in described housing, described scraper component is connected by transmission component with described magnet assemblies, described enclosure interior is provided with the motor being connected with described magnet assemblies, magnet assemblies described in described driven by motor rotates, described scraper component links with described magnet assemblies, iron filings on described end face and are stopped to described side by described scraper component in the suction lower slider of described magnet assemblies, and then depart from described side and fall in iron filings groove.By providing a kind of iron filings from arranging device, it is achieved iron filings reclaim automatically, keep equipment cleaning, slow down motion abrasion, improve equipment life.

Background technology
The internal operations of plant equipment or in the processing procedure of workpiece, inevitably because of various frictions Producing iron filings more or less, iron filings are not cleared up, and may enter in the moving component of plant equipment, Greatly accelerate the abrasion of equipment, even directly affect the normal operation of equipment.Based on above-mentioned situation, I Be necessary in the original structure of various equipment to increase iron filings from arranging device, it is achieved the automatic receipts of iron filings Collection, improves the service life of equipment.

Detailed description of the invention
Further illustrate technical scheme below in conjunction with the accompanying drawings and by detailed description of the invention.
As shown in Fig. 1~2, in the present embodiment, a kind of iron filings are from arranging device, including housing 1, scraper plate group Part 3, magnet assemblies 2, transmission component 4 and motor 5, the end face 11 of housing 1 is smooth flat, housing 1 Side 12 be semi arch shiny surface, be provided with for accommodating magnetic along end face 11 and side 12 inside housing 1 The chute 13 of iron component 2, in the present embodiment, the both sides of end face 11 and side 12 are provided with chute 13. Side 12 has arc top line 121, and arc top line 121 on the side 12 is away from 1/4th of end face 11 side On arc surface.
Corresponding arc top line 121 is also in the side away from housing 1 and is provided with scraper component 3, and scraper component 3 wraps Include rotating shaft 31 and the scraper plate being fixed in rotating shaft 31, scraper plate with rotating shaft 31 as axis rotation and with arc top line 121 Intermittent Contact.Scraper plate includes at least one piece of first scraper plate 32 and at least one piece of second scraper plate 33, the first scraper plate 32 are symmetrical arranged with the second scraper plate 33.
In the present embodiment, rotating shaft 31 is provided with three piece of first scraper plate 32 and three piece of second scraper plate 33, often Angle between two piece of first scraper plate 32 is 15 degree, and the angle between every two piece of second scraper plate 33 is 15 degree, First scraper plate 32 is located remotely from each other with the second scraper plate 33 and is symmetrical arranged.
Being provided with the magnet assemblies 2 can slided along chute 13 in housing 1, magnet assemblies 2 is included in chute 13 The electric magnet 21 of interior slip and the shrinking connecting-rod 22 that be connected fixing with electric magnet 21, the two ends of electric magnet 21 are equal Inserting in chute 13, shrinking connecting-rod 22 is fixed on central shaft 23 away from one end of electric magnet 21, center Axle 23 is rotatably provided on housing 1.In the present embodiment, the quantity of electric magnet 21 is two, two Electric magnet 21 is symmetrical arranged, and two electric magnet 21 are connected to shrinking connecting-rod 22, two shrinking connecting-rods 22 It is fixedly connected with on central shaft 23, two electric magnet 21 corresponding first scraper plate 32 and the second scraper plates 33 respectively.
In other embodiments, arc top line 121 position is also additionally provided with gang switch 6, when electric magnet 21 Turning to arc top line 121 position and touch gang switch 6, gang switch 6 is controlled by controller and disconnects electricity The conducting loop of Magnet 21, makes electric magnet 21 lose magnetic force, in order to iron filings preferably depart from side 12 and fall Enter in iron filings groove.
Scraper component 3 and magnet assemblies 2 is connected by transmission component 4, during transmission component 4 has and is fixed on The first gear 41 in mandrel 23 and be fixed in rotating shaft 31 and with the second of the first gear 41 synchronous axial system Gear 42, the first gear 41 and the number of teeth of the second gear 42, modulus are the most consistent, the first gear 41 and second Gear 42 is in transmission connection by chain 43.In other embodiments, the first gear 41 and the second gear 42 Can also be connected by gear drive.
Housing 1 is internally provided with the motor 5 driving magnet assemblies 2 and scraper component 3 to rotate.In the present embodiment In, the outfan of motor 5 is connected with central shaft 23, and motor 5 directly drives magnet assemblies 2 to rotate, scraper plate Assembly 3 is followed magnet assemblies 2 by transmission component 4 and is rotated.
